Apartment for sale, Via Istria, in Viterbo, Italy

We are located in the Ellera neighborhood, close to the walls of the historic center of Viterbo and full of all amenities from supermarkets to schools. In one of the most central streets of this area, on Istria street, we will show you a 65 sqm attic and a beautiful terrace of about 30 sqm where you can spend lunches and dinners in company, next to which is a cozy veranda where you can spend time in peace and relaxation! After entering through the main door we are greeted by the different rooms of the house, divided into a bright kitchen-dining room, living room, master bedroom with balcony and bathroom with shower.
